首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将外部文本文件中的文本导入html / jinja日志报告

将外部文本文件中的文本导入HTML/Jinja日志报告可以通过以下步骤实现:

  1. 首先,需要使用后端开发技术来读取外部文本文件的内容。根据具体的编程语言,可以使用文件操作相关的函数或库来实现。例如,在Python中,可以使用内置的open()函数来打开文件,并使用read()函数来读取文件内容。
  2. 接下来,将读取到的文本内容进行处理和格式化,以便在HTML/Jinja日志报告中展示。可以使用字符串处理函数或正则表达式来对文本进行分割、替换、过滤等操作,以满足展示需求。
  3. 然后,使用前端开发技术来创建HTML/Jinja模板,用于生成日志报告的页面结构和样式。可以使用HTML、CSS和JavaScript等技术来设计和布局报告页面,以及添加交互和动态效果。
  4. 在HTML/Jinja模板中,使用相应的语法或标记来插入处理后的文本内容。例如,在Jinja模板中,可以使用{{}}标记来插入变量或表达式的值,以及{% %}标记来执行控制流语句或循环。
  5. 最后,将生成的HTML/Jinja日志报告保存为一个文件,或通过网络进行展示。可以使用后端开发技术来将报告保存为文件,或使用Web框架来将报告作为HTTP响应返回给客户端。

这样,就可以将外部文本文件中的文本导入HTML/Jinja日志报告,并通过浏览器或其他方式进行查看和分析。

在腾讯云的产品中,可以使用云服务器(CVM)来搭建后端开发环境,使用云数据库(CDB)来存储和管理文本数据,使用云函数(SCF)来处理文本内容并生成报告,使用云存储(COS)来保存报告文件,使用云网络(VPC)来搭建网络环境等。具体产品介绍和链接地址如下:

  • 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。产品介绍链接
  • 云数据库(CDB):提供高可用、可扩展的数据库服务,支持多种数据库引擎。产品介绍链接
  • 云函数(SCF):无服务器计算服务,可按需运行代码片段,用于处理文本内容并生成报告。产品介绍链接
  • 云存储(COS):提供安全可靠的对象存储服务,用于保存报告文件。产品介绍链接
  • 云网络(VPC):提供灵活可扩展的私有网络,用于搭建网络环境。产品介绍链接

以上是一个基本的答案示例,具体的实现方式和腾讯云产品选择可以根据实际需求和情况进行调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何excel数据导入mysql_外部sql文件导入MySQL步骤

大家好,又见面了,我是你们朋友全栈君。 客户准备了一些数据存放在 excel , 让我们导入到 mysql 。...后来发现有更简单方法: 1 先把数据拷贝到 txt 文件 2 打开 mysql 命令行执行下面的命令就行了 LOAD DATA LOCAL INFILE ‘C:\\temp\\yourfile.txt..., field2) 指明对应字段名称 下面是我导入数据命令,成功导入 (我是 mac 系统) LOAD DATA LOCAL INFILE ‘/Users/Enway/LeslieFang/aaa.txt...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站立刻删除。...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/191119.html原文链接:https://javaforall.cn

5.4K30

包含数字形式文本文件导入Excel时保留文本格式VBA自定义函数

标签:VBA Q:有一个文本文件,其内容包含很多以0开头数字,如下图1所示,当将该文件导入Excel时,Excel会将这些值解析为数字,删除了开头“0”。...图1 我该如何原值导入Excel工作表? A:我们使用一个VBA自定义函数来解决。...参数strPath是要导入文本文件所在路径及文件名,参数strDelim是文本文件中用于分隔值分隔符。...假设一个名为“myFile.txt”文件存储在路径“C:\test\”,可以使用下面的过程来调用这个自定义函数: Sub test() Dim var As Variant '根据实际修改为相应文件路径和分隔符....Value = var '插入数组值 End With End Sub 这将打开指定文本文件,并使用提供分隔符将其读入,返回一个二维数组。

25710
  • 【DB笔试面试446】如何文本文件或Excel数据导入数据库?

    题目部分 如何文本文件或Excel数据导入数据库?...答案部分 有多种方式可以文本文件数据导入到数据库,例如,利用PLSQL Developer软件进行复制粘贴,利用外部表,利用SQL*Loader等方式。...至于EXCEL数据可以另存为csv文件(csv文件其实是逗号分隔文本文件),然后导入到数据库。 下面简单介绍一下SQL*Loader使用方式。...SQL*Loader是一个Oracle工具,能够数据从外部数据文件装载到数据库。...② 采用DIRECT=TRUE导入可以跳过数据库相关逻辑,直接数据导入到数据文件,可以提高导入数据性能。 ③ 通过指定UNRECOVERABLE选项,可以写少量日志,而从提高数据加载性能。

    4.6K20

    问与答61: 如何一个文本文件满足指定条件内容筛选到另一个文本文件

    图1 现在,我要将以60至69开头行放置到另一个名为“OutputFile.csv”文件。...图1只是给出了少量示例数据,我数据有几千行,如何快速对这些数据进行查找并将满足条件行复制到新文件?...ReadLine变量 Line Input #1, ReadLine 'ReadLine字符串拆分成数组 buf =Split(ReadLine,...4.Line Input语句从文件号#1文件逐行读取其内容并将其赋值给变量ReadLine。 5.Split函数字符串使用指定空格分隔符拆分成下标以0为起始值一维数组。...6.Print语句ReadLine变量字符串写入文件号#2文件。 7.Close语句关闭指定文件。 代码图片版如下: ?

    4.3K10

    如何使用mapXploreSQLMap数据转储到关系型数据库

    mapXplore是一款功能强大SQLMap数据转储与管理工具,该工具基于模块化理念开发,可以帮助广大研究人员SQLMap数据提取出来,并转储到类似PostgreSQL或SQLite等关系型数据库...功能介绍 当前版本mapXplore支持下列功能: 1、数据提取和转储:将从SQLMap中提取到数据转储到PostgreSQL或SQLite以便进行后续查询; 2、数据清洗:在导入数据过程,该工具会将无法读取数据解码或转换成可读信息...; 3、数据查询:支持在所有的数据表查询信息,例如密码、用户和其他信息; 4、自动转储信息以Base64格式存储,例如:Word、Excel、PowerPoint、.zip文件、文本文件、明文信息、...图片和PDF等; 5、过滤表和列; 6、根据不同类型哈希函数过滤数据; 7、将相关信息导出为Excel或HTML; 工具要求 cmd2==2.4.3 colored==2.2.4 Jinja2==3.1.2...: 保存数据: Base64报告HTML导出: 项目地址 mapXplore: https://github.com/daniel2005d/mapXplore

    11710

    使用 Pandas, Jinja 和 WeasyPrint,轻松创建一个 PDF 报表

    我们都知道,Pandas 擅长处理大量数据并以多种文本和视觉表示形式对其进行总结,它支持结构输出到 CSV、Excel、HTML、json 等。...本文介绍一种多条信息组合成 HTML 模板,然后使用 Jinja 模板和 WeasyPrint 将其转换为独立 PDF 文档方法,一起来看看吧~ 总体流程 如报告文章所示,使用 Pandas 数据输出到...Jinja,我们需要做 3 件事: 创建模板 变量添加到模板上下文中 模板渲染成 HTML 我们先创建一个简单模板 myreport.html <!...包含允许我们引入一段 HTML 并在代码不同部分重复使用它。在这种情况下,摘要包含一些我们希望在每个报告包含简单国家级统计数据,以便管理人员可以将他们绩效与全国平均水平进行比较。...这是使用 Jinja 过滤器一个具体示例 还有一个 for 循环允许我们在报告显示每个经理详细信息。

    2K20

    Jinja2用法总结

    二:模板概要 Jinja模板是简单一个纯文本文件,一般用html页面来书写。 1. 2. 3....在开发,会将一些常用宏单独放在一个文件,在需要使用时候,再从这个文件中进行导入。...dd>{{ forms.input('password', type='password') }} {{ forms.textarea('comment') }} 导入模板并不会把当前上下文中变量添加到被导入模板...,我们可以在导入时候使用with context 把上下文传进去: {% from '_helpers.html' import my_macro with context %} 2)宏文件引用其它宏...否则,这些文本和标签将不会被渲染。(因为子模板相当于把内容嵌入到父模板到block,而没有写到block内容当然不会被嵌入,也就不会被渲染。)

    2.1K10

    给Python新人练手准备十个简单趣味脚本

    目录文件分类 前言 有时候,想要对一个目录里文件进行搜索或者分类操作往往是一件痛苦事情,下面这个程序目的是目录下文件树以某种分类规则进行排列。...文本备份云仓库 前言 everbox是一个evernote作为文件沙盒接口集合,利用evernote作为文本存储仓库,方便地对文本文件进行管理。...推送所有文本 log 查看文件在仓库记录 输出 pull 从仓库拉取文件 输出...用法 输出 源码 05. html生成器 前言 用python生成html 用法...2013国城市可持续发展指数报告珠海综合排名全国第一,珠海为中国新兴城市50强,新型花园城市;珠海属国家新颁布“幸福之城”,有“浪漫之城”称号。

    1.1K100

    Flask模板引擎Jinja2使用实例

    Flask提供模板引擎为Jinja2,易于使用,功能强大。 模板仅仅是文本文件,它可以生成任何基于文本格式(HTML、XML、CSV、LaTex 等等)。...它并没有特定扩展名, .html 或 .xml 都是可以。 模板包含 变量 或 表达式 ,这两者在模板求值时候会被替换为值。模板还有标签,控制模板逻辑。...Jinja2文档:http://docs.jinkan.org/docs/jinja2/index.html 下面是一些使用实例,涉及模板继续、变量、赋值、循环、去空白、转义块、条件语句等。...2、同样在目录templates下面创建子模板文件test1.html {% extends 'base.html' %} {# 这里是注释,上面标签表示当前模板继承自模板base.html #}...,希望对大家学习有所帮助。

    1K20

    hive textfile 数据错行

    本文介绍如何处理HiveTextFile数据错行情况。问题描述TextFile格式数据在存储和处理过程,可能会因为文本文件本身格式问题或者数据写入时异常情况,导致数据错行情况出现。...通过自定义serde,可以更灵活地控制数据解析过程,从而处理数据错行情况。2. 预处理数据在数据导入Hive前,可以对原始数据进行预处理,错行数据修复或者丢弃,确保数据符合预期格式。...处理包含错行数据日志文件假设我们有一个存储用户行为日志文本文件 user_logs.txt,其中包含了用户ID、操作时间和操作内容,但由于异常情况,有些行数据错乱导致数据错行情况。...HiveTextFile是一种Hive数据存储格式,它是一种存储在Hadoop文件系统文本文件,每一行数据都被视为一条记录。...数据加载:初步加载数据时使用,可以通过简单文本文件快速导入数据。中小规模数据存储:对于中小规模数据存储和查询,TextFile格式是一个常见选择。

    13010

    Web Hacking 101 中文版 十六、模板注入

    这里,page_not_found函数渲染了 HTML,开发者 URL 格式化为字符串并将其展示给用户。...因此,漏洞是存在,允许攻击者执行 Python 代码。 现在,Jinja2 尝试通过执行放入沙箱来缓和伤害,意思是功能有限,但是偶尔能被绕过。...这里,Flask 和 Jinja2 变成了极好攻击向量。并且,在这个有一些 XSS 漏洞例子,漏洞可能不是那么直接或者明显,要确保检查了所有文本渲染地方。...0752 报告日期:2015.2.1 奖金:无 描述: 在这个利用研究,nVisium 提供了一个 NB 截断和遍历。...处理 Rails 时候,开发者能够隐式或者显式控制渲染什么,基于传给函数参数。所以,开发者能够显式控制作为文本、JSON、HTML,或者一些其他文件内容。

    3.7K10

    带你认识 flask 国际化和本地化

    支持多语言常规流程是在源代码中标记所有需要翻译文本文本标记后,Flask-Babel扫描所有文件,并使用gettext工具这些文本提取到单独翻译文件。...这是一个文本文件,其中包含所有标记为需要翻译文本。这个文件目的是作为一个模板来为每种语言创建翻译文件。 提取过程需要一个小型配置文件,告诉pybabel哪些文件应该被扫描以获得可翻译文本。...下面你可以看到我为这个应用创建babel.cfg: babel.cfg:PyBabel配置文件 [python: app/**.py][jinja2: app/templates/**.html]extensions...如果你擅长编辑文本文件,量少时候也就罢了,但如果你正在处理大型项目,可能会推荐使用专门编辑器。最流行翻译应用程序是开源poedit,可用于所有主流操作系统。...Click命令中提供值作为参数传递给处理函数,然后将该参数并入到init命令 启用这些命令最后一步是导入它们,以便注册命令。

    1.8K30

    全文1w字,蓝图、会话、日志、部署等使用Flask搭建中小型企业级项目

    好啦,打开我们蓝色链接,我们第一个flask程序就写好了外部服务器(--host)运行服务时候,只能本地访问,而网络其他电脑却访问不了。...使用Jinja(这个稍后会介绍)渲染 HTML 模板会自动执行此操作。...多用途文本生成:模板技术不仅适用于创建HTML网页,同样能够用来生成包括Markdown、纯文本等在内多种文本文件格式。...网页内容生成:在web应用开发,模板引擎是生成HTML页面的关键工具,但它们应用远不止于此。扩展性:模板系统设计使其能够轻松扩展到其他文本格式,如电子邮件所需文本格式,提供灵活性。...日志和错误监控使用Sentry等工具监控和报告错误。集成WSGI中间件通过app.wsgi_app属性集成中间件。

    2.9K11

    Access获取外部数据(一)

    在使用数据过程,实际上直接向数据库输入数据是十分少见,更多情况是直接使用已使用数据文件,可以避免需要重复输入数据麻烦。本节先介绍导入和导出数据。...可以将其他Access数据库、Excel表格、ODBC数据库、HTML文档和文本文件导入到当前在Access数据库。 选择外部数据选项卡--新数据源,可以根据需要选择。 ?...一种是源数据导入到当前数据库表,一种是通过创建链接表来链接数据源。(采用导入就是数据复制到Access,创建表来保存数据,与数据源数据无关联。...其他文件导入方式相似,主要在于导入和链接区别。 ---- 二、导出 导出数据较为简单,在外部数据选项,选择导出文件类型,Access数据库可以导出Excel、PDF、文本文件等多种文件格式。...今天下雨 本节主要介绍了Access与外部数据交换方式中导入、导出,下一节介绍链接方式,祝大家学习快乐,记得戴口罩,勤洗手。

    2.9K10

    测试开发-web开发和flask

    20221110_测试开发-web开发和flask 本文讲述web后端框架及flask简单实现 概念 web开发 web即万维网, 基于html和超文本图形信息系统, web应用基本上就是指现在B/S...我们只需要: 导入flask并初始化一个Flask应用对象,导入request对象 编写处理函数, 在业务函数下,拿取request请求数据,编写业务代码返回 在Flask对象route方法填写对应请求路径及请求方法...,装饰业务处理函数, 运行过程: flask接受到WSGI服务器传递请求, 根据请求请求方法和path,请求交给对应处理函数 处理函数通过request对象拿取请求数据, 处理后返回响应数据 flask...在model取特定数据交给View生成html页面,返回给前段 以flask为例 我们需要: 安装Jinja2, tempaltes文件夹下编写html模板,使用Jinja2语法定义渲染效果(比如对需要变更内容进行参数化...在同级目录下 运行过程: 运行到render_template函数时, 程序会自动到templates文件夹下寻找对应名称模板 render_template参数传递给Jinja Jinja根据参数对模板进行渲染

    7710

    MySQL客户端和服务器端工具集

    在 UNIX MySQL 分发版包括 mysql.server 脚本。 7) mysqlbug MySQL 缺陷报告脚本。它可以用来向 MySQL 邮件系统发送缺陷报告。...4) mysqladmin 执行管理操作客户程序,例如创建或删除数据库、重载授权表、表刷新到硬盘上以及重新打开日志文件。Mysqladmin 还可以用来检索版本、进程以及服务器状态信息。...5) mysqlbinlog 从二进制日志读取语句工具。在二进制日志文件包含执行过语句,可用来帮助系统从崩溃恢复。 6) mysqlcheck 检查、修复、分析以及优化表表维护客户程序。...7) mysqldump MySQL 数据库转储到一个文件(例如 SQL 语句或 Tab 分隔符文本文件客户程序。...9) mysql import 使用 LOAD DATA INFILE 文本文件导入相应客户程序。 10) mysqlshow 显示数据库、表、列以及索引相关信息客户程序。

    1.3K20

    用Python三步生成带有图表word报表

    2.我们在word如果只是引用路径,那么生成word就会出现找不到图片,此时,我们应该使用下面这个函数图片转化为字节数据: 此时我们就拿到了我们想要数据 我们可以所需要画图封装成一个工具类...2,使用sublime或者其他文本编辑打开xml文件,在模板相应位置替换成渲染数据模型,具体语法和Django模板语法基本一致,如: 三 利用jinja2库渲染修改好模板,然后写入.doc文件即可...1.导入jinja2模块和相应模块 2.加载我们刚刚编辑好word模板 3.打开和渲染模板 其中w_id和w_pname属性是word图片属性,只要每一张图片id name唯一即可 全部代码如下...: 运行代码,即可生成我们想要word报表 参考资料及其链接: Jinja2 安装: pychartdir 安装: Python 要使用pychartdir绘图的话需要安装pychartdir...3.帮助文档Installation中有描述安装方法: 在python安装目录下Libsite-packages目录下新建chartdirector目录 解压后ChartDirectorlib

    1.3K00
    领券